Read to Lead: Top 5 Business Books That Shaped 2024’s Leadership Trends

The business world of 2024 has been significantly shaped by groundbreaking insights from the latest leadership and management practices. Here, we delve into the top 5 business books that have made a profound impact on leadership trends this year, offering reviews and recommendations for each. These selections not only reflect the current business zeitgeist but also provide actionable strategies for navigating the complexities of today’s corporate landscape.

1. “The Technology Trap: Capital, Labor, and Power in the Age of Automation” by Carl Benedikt Frey

This book takes a historical look at automation’s impact on the workforce, presenting a nuanced analysis that is critical for understanding how to navigate the challenges and opportunities presented by AI and automation in the workplace.

2. “Analog” by Robert Hassan

Hassan’s work explores the craving for authentic experiences in a digital-saturated age, offering insights into balancing innovation with the human touch in business practices.

3. “The Art of the Good Life: Clear Thinking for Business and a Better Life” by Rolf Dobelli

Dobelli provides a modern take on stoic philosophy, presenting clear, actionable advice for improving decision-making and achieving a better life through simple, thought-provoking principles.

4. “Scale: The Universal Laws of Life, Growth, and Death in Organisms, Cities, and Companies” by Geoffrey West

West’s book is a fascinating exploration of the patterns that underlie the success and failure of businesses and other organizations, offering key insights into sustainability and growth.

5. “The Hard Thing About Hard Things” by Ben Horowitz

Horowitz shares candid advice and personal anecdotes from his experiences in Silicon Valley, focusing on the difficult decisions and challenges faced by leaders and entrepreneurs.
